Meet Lomoro Emmanuel Founder of Generous Designs Africa
Emmanuel Lomoro is a refugee entrepreneur and founder of Generous Designs Africa (DGA), a refugee-led initiative in Bidibidi that transforms discarded plastic waste into reusable and practical products. His work demonstrates how environmental challenges can be turned into opportunities for innovation, entrepreneurship and community livelihoods.
Emmanuel has been a scholar at SINA Loketa since 2019, where he developed his entrepreneurial skills and grew his business idea through mentorship, practical learning and support from SINA Loketa’s Start-up Lab programme. Through this support, he transformed his idea into a social enterprise focused on addressing plastic waste while creating livelihood opportunities.
The impact of his work extends beyond recycling. DGA has created employment opportunities for more than 15 single mothers, whom Emmanuel has trained in tailoring, plastic recycling and school-bag production. By combining skills development with waste recycling and product creation, the enterprise has helped women develop practical skills and income-generating opportunities while contributing to a cleaner community.
In 2025, Emmanuel was among the winners of the UNHCR Innovation Fund Award, recognising his innovative approach and commitment to community-led solutions. He is also one of the verified businesses on the Flexi Start-up Platform, giving DGA greater visibility and access to business development, mentorship, networking and potential market and investment opportunities.
Emmanuel’s journey from a SINA Loketa scholar to a refugee-led social entrepreneur demonstrates the power of mentorship, practical entrepreneurship training and sustained support in enabling refugees to become innovators, job creators and agents of positive change.
